    Maybe it's my imagination (probably is) but it seems like 450s in general have taken a bit of a back seat compared to where they used to be in terms of popularity. The exception perhaps being the new Blade models.

    So much of this year has been either quite windy or low clouds (which equals low light) that I let my Beam E4 sit on the shelf until just the last month or so when I started flying it again. I had forgotten how good it is. Even in pretty windy conditions it just sits rock solid and tracks in a straight line (and that's totally stock and still with a flybar).

    It got me thinking, where are all the 450s these days? And what about the XCell 450 and the mini Protos and the new TT Mini Titan? As I say, maybe it's just me and the clubs I fly at. There is one club with a regular flyer that has a 450 Pro and that's pretty much all he flies but otherwise they have been scarce. Maybe, like myself, it has just seemed like the weather wasn't suitable so the bigger helis have been getting flown and the 450 stayed behind.

    Anyway, 'just thinking out loud really. I'm very happy to be flying the Beam again and the more I fly it the more I want to fly it, so it will probably be coming to the field with me most days now.

    When it was so cloudy and dark earlier in the year I discovered that the Trex 450 SE series canopy fits straight on, so I have been using a bright orange one when the light hasn't been too good.

          Yeah, I suppose it could be two scenarios; For those that have more than one heli and end up finding they just tend to fly another one more and feel the 450 is collecting dust and may as well be sold. The other possibility being those that don't tend to have lots of helis at once and if the only heli they have is a 450 then they start looking to move up to something bigger and sell the 450 first.

          It may seem odd but by the middle of last year what I wasn't flying nearly as much were my .50 nitros. I felt like I'd rather spend my flying time with a .90 but the 450 (and later the 500) were still nice changes of pace rather than just the same heli back to back (plus the fuel costs would really get prohibitive if I only flew a .90 nitro).

          The other thing for me was that I used to fly with a few friends that had 450s and then that stopped due to various reasons, so there had been something of a time and a place that then changed.
